ACC Basketball Tournament 2011 Bracket Update: Clemson Moves On To Face North Carolina In Semis

Clemson turned an eight point half time lead into a 70-47 win over Boston College. Demontez Stitt did a little bit of everything for the Tigers recording 20 points, eight rebounds, and four assists. Jerai Grant and Milton Jennings added 12 and 10 points respectively. Clemson shot lights out from three-point range going 8-17 for distance for the game. 

Joe Trapani led the way for Boston College with 20 points while Reggie Jackson added 11.

Clemson advances to the semifinals of the ACC Tournament where it will take on North Carolina who survived a thriller earlier today against Miami. Clemson lost both meetings with Carolina on the season falling 75-65 at home and 64-62 in Chapel Hill.

Updated ACC tournament bracket (all times EST):

Thursday, March 10 - First Round

No. 9 Miami def. No. 8 Virginia Cavaliers, 69-62
No. 5 Boston College def. No. 12 Wake Forest, 81-67
No. 7 Maryland def. No. 10 NC State, 75-67
No. 6 Virginia Tech def. No. 11 Georgia Tech, 59-43

Friday, March 11 - Quarterfinals

No. 1 North Carolina def. Miami, 61-59
No. 4 Clemson def. Boston College, 70-47
No. 2 Duke vs. NC State, 7 p.m., ACC Network/ESPN2
No. 3 Florida State vs. Virginia Tech, 9 p.m., ACC Network/ESPN2

Saturday, March 12 - Semifinals

UNC vs. Clemson, ACC Network/ESPN
ACC Semifinal 2, 3 p.m., ACC Network/ESPN

Sunday, March 13 - Championship

Championship Game, 1 p.m., ACC Network/ESPN
